FALMOUTH — Elizabeth Green Guptill, 81, formerly of Portland, died March 5 at Sedgewood Commons.

Born in Portland on April 21, 1929,  a daughter of Patrick H. and Barbara E. (Davis) Green, she attended Portland schools and graduated from Portland High School in 1947.

Later, she graduated from Northeast Business College.

On Oct. 25, 1952, she married Royce C. Guptill in Portland.

For 30 years she worked as a bookkeeper for Ballard Oil before working for G.M. Pollock Jewelers.

After she retired in 1991 she enjoyed spending her free time reading.

She was very proud of her Irish heritage and devoted to her Catholic faith.

Her husband Royce predeceased her June 1, 2005. She was also predeceased by a sister, Mary F. Green, and two brothers, John P. Green and Joseph H. Green.

Surviving are her four children, Colleen M. Browne of Gorham, Kathleen A. Levesque and her husband Andre of Gorham, Ellen R. Guptill of Portland, and Royce M. Guptill and his wife Betsy of Gorham; a sister, Sister Catherine Green, RSM, of Portland; nine grandchildren, Andrew, Mark, Susan, and Matthew Levesque, Megan Bernier, Patricia Valente, Royce and Alexander Guptill, and Travis Cline; and six great-grandchildren.

Memorial services were held Monday, March 7.

Arrangements are by Conroy-Tully Crawford Funeral Home, 172 State St., Portland.
